Plant a Sapling; I-Care Plus Programme at GIIS Noida

School is a place which garners a sense of responsibility towards nature and its conservation among students. Since children are the future of tomorrow, educating them about preserving and balancing the environment becomes highly essential.

Promoting conservation of the greens and sensitivity towards the global issues, Global Indian International School (GIIS) Noida has designed a specific I-Care programme for the pre-primary and Grade 1& 2 students of the school. This programme helps a child in developing consciousness towards the environmental issues and the world they live in.

As a part of the I-Care programme, the theme for the month of February (for Montessori Wing and Grades 1&2) was Plant a Sapling. The concept was introduced as an indoor activity to the tiny tots. Children along with their class teachers planted seeds in little cups.

Students got to know about things required to grow and nurture a plant, various parts of the plant, and the importance they hold in our lives. Plants with medicinal values like neem, tulsi, amla, etc. were introduced to the pre-nursery, nursery and KG students. It was a fun filled day for our little stars, as they got to understand about the benefits of few plants with medicinal values and how they can help us in our day to day lives.

As they say learning is doing, children from grades 1&2 also had a fun filled Plant a Sapling activity. This activity served as an ideal opportunity for the kids to understand their social responsibility towards Mother Earth. Fascinated by the seed sowing process, hands on experience of planting seeds manually was the outcome obtained from the activity. It formed a personal connect between the students and the environment through a process of experience, reflection and creation. Students were also educated about plants that act as herbs and the medicinal value they contain for our general health and living.

The objective behind conducting this activity was to create awareness about our environment’s well-being, energy conservation and believe in the power of natural ingredients that do so much of good to human beings in more ways than imagined.
